import { View, Text, StyleSheet, Switch, SwitchProps, useColorScheme, TouchableOpacityProps, TouchableOpacity } from 'react-native'
import React from 'react'
import { SIZES } from '../../../constants/theme'
import { useTheme } from '../../../app/contexts/ThemeContext';
interface ToggleSettingProps extends SwitchProps {
settingsTitle: string;
}
export function ToggleSetting(props: ToggleSettingProps) {
const {settingsTitle, ...rest} = props;
const { colors } = useTheme()
return (
{settingsTitle}
)
}
interface ButtonSettingProps extends TouchableOpacityProps {
settingsTitle: string,
}
export function ButtonSetting(props: ButtonSettingProps){
const {settingsTitle, ...rest} = props;
const { colors } = useTheme();
return (
{settingsTitle}
)
}
const styles = StyleSheet.create({
settingTitle: {
fontSize: SIZES.large
},
settingsTile: {
width: "100%",
minHeight: 60,
paddingVertical: 5,
paddingHorizontal: 20,
borderRadius: 80,
flexDirection: "row",
alignItems: "center",
justifyContent: "space-between",
marginBottom: 10
}
})